Sonam Bajwa says there is no competition between her and Shehnaaz Gill: ‘But I will be very honest..’
Sonam Bajwa has opened up about her bond with Shehnaaz Gill and revealed what happened while they were shooting for the film Honsla Rakh.

Actor Sonam Bajwa, who co-starred with Shehnaaz Gill in the Punjabi movie Honsla Rakh, recently said that she doesn’t consider Shehnaaz to be competition. Sonam said that while working with Shehnaaz, she felt more responsible and also revealed that they bonded well on the sets.
In an interview with Siddharth Kannan, Sonam said, “There was no competition because honestly I was so secured by what I was going to do on screen. There was no competition like that, but I will be very honest, when I was doing a song with her, she was so good as dancer I was like ‘wow.’ We were teaching each other steps. When your co-star performs well on sets, you feel ‘even I want to do.’ It made me feel more responsible. So yes, we did bond.”

Sonam also praised Shehnaaz’s energy and revealed that she made sets a fun place. About the film Honsla Rakh, Sonam said, “Unfortunately we did not even have a lot of scenes together. We were together in one song and we had a lot of fun.” The film also starred Diljit Dosanjh.
Sonam will next be seen in the Punjabi film Godday Godday Chaa. She also has Carry on Jatta 3 which is helmed by Smeep Kang and the film will hit the theatres on June 29. As for Shehnaaz, she was recently seen in Salman Khan’s Kisi Ka Bhai Kisi Ki Jaan. The film also starred Pooja Hegde, Raghav Juyal, Palak Tiwari and Bhumika Chawla among others.
